The Applied Art of Acting now enrolling for September Course
18 Jan 2017 : Katie McNeice
The three-month training initiative is currently accepting applications for new students of all levels of experience.

The Applied Art of Acting offers personalised and diagnostic training for each participant, covering both stage and screen performance.

Audition and screen-test techniques are covered in addition to vocal and physical training.

Graduates of the course include Emily Lamey, who landed roles in both BAFTA-nominated short film ‘The Party’ and feature film ‘South’—the directorial debut from Gerard Walsh.
